Spieler      modified DLL code for slide redirection. *//*   Explode imploded (PKZIP method 6 compressed) data.  This compression   method searches for as much of the current string of bytes (up to a length   of ~320) in the previous 4K or 8K bytes.  If it doesn't find any matches   (of at least length 2 or 3), it codes the next byte.  Otherwise, it codes   the length of the matched string and its distance backwards from the   current position.  Single bytes ("literals") are preceded by a one (a   single bit) and are either uncoded (the eight bits go directly into the   compressed stream for a total of nine bits) or Huffman coded with a   supplied literal code tree.  If literals are coded, then the minimum match   length is three, otherwise it is two.   There are therefore four kinds of imploded streams: 8K search with coded   literals (min match = 3), 4K search with coded literals (min match = 3),   8K with uncoded literals (min match = 2), and 4K with uncoded literals   (min match = 2).  The kind of stream is identified in two bits of a   general purpose bit flag that is outside of the compressed stream.   Distance-length pairs for matched strings are preceded by a zero bit (to   distinguish them from literals) and are always coded.  The distance comes   first and is either the low six (4K) or low seven (8K) bits of the   distance (uncoded), followed by the high six bits of the distance coded.   Then the length is six bits coded (0..63 + min match length), and if the   maximum such length is coded, then it's followed by another eight bits   (uncoded) to be added to the coded length.  This gives a match length   range of 2..320 or 3..321 bytes.   The literal, length, and distance codes are all represented in a slightly   compressed form themselves.  What is sent are the lengths of the codes for   each value, which is sufficient to construct the codes.  Each byte of the   code representation is the code length (the low four bits representing   1..16), and the number of values sequentially with that length (the high   four bits also representing 1..16).  There are 256 literal code values (if   literals are coded), 64 length code values, and 64 distance code values,   in that order at the beginning of the compressed stream.  Each set of code   values is preceded (redundantly) with a byte indicating how many bytes are   in the code description that follows, in the range 1..256.   The codes themselves are decoded using tables made by huft_build() from   the bit lengths.
